What Is Tennessee’s New Pet Feeder Law?

Tennessee has recently passed a new law regulating the use of automated pet feeders, aiming to ensure the safety and well-being of pets. The law addresses concerns about unattended feeding, pet health, and responsible pet ownership.

Why the Law Was Introduced

Automated pet feeders have become increasingly popular among pet owners who work long hours or travel frequently. However, concerns arose about the overuse of these devices, leading to potential neglect. Some cases showed that improperly maintained feeders could malfunction, leaving pets without food or dispensing excessive amounts.

Key Provisions of the Law

The new Tennessee pet feeder law includes several important rules:

  1. Regular Supervision Required: Pet owners must check automated feeders at least once a day to ensure proper functioning.
  2. Feeder Quality Standards: Only certified pet feeders that meet safety and hygiene standards can be sold in the state.
  3. Limits on Remote Feeding: Owners cannot rely solely on an automated feeder for more than 48 hours. If away for longer, arrangements for human supervision are required.
  4. Fines for Violations: Pet owners who fail to follow the law may face fines or penalties for animal neglect.

Impact on Pet Owners

While the law promotes responsible pet care, some pet owners have expressed concerns about added regulations. However, animal welfare groups have praised the law for ensuring that pets receive proper nutrition and supervision.
